Member 1 of Group A sends a request via the winuser portal. Member 1 goes on vacation. Member 2 of Group A wants to edit the incident sent by Member 1. The members of the Group A are not workers. Is this possible? If not, is there a workaround to make this happen?
If Member 1 forwards the acknowledge generated email to the other members of the group with the Incident # on the Subject Line, will Altiris HelpDesk edit the incident if Member 2 sends the email to the email Inbox?

Your e-mail idea should work
Your e-mail idea should work, but I haven't tested this. It's creative, though, and more than that -- it should work!
There is not another way to do what you're asking unless the Contact is modified to Member 2 from Member 1.

It worked! I had to modify the email Inbox by adding the following in "For Existing Incidents":
Set "Action" to "Edit"
When I view the incident after I sent the email, Modified by is equal to HelpDesk. Can I add another line above so that I can set the Modified by to the sender of the email? If this is not possible, it may not be a big deal since in the history portion you will see the email address of the sender of the email. But I think it will be sweet if that can be changed to reflect the sender's name as the person editing the incident.
